debut
A performer's first performance to the public, in sport, the arts or some other area.
Hulking defenceman Gudbranson, who came to Vancouver in a trade with the Florida Panthers last May, scored in his debut for the Canucks.
Liverpool's performance - despite a defensive injury crisis that saw a promising debut for teenage academy graduate John Flanagan - was a resounding advert for Kenny Dalglish to be…

debutar
to formally introduce, as to the public
Amalgamated Software Systems debuted release 3.2 in Spring of 2004.
He recently debuted a preview of his cover of Cher’s 1998 hit “Believe” on his official Instagram account.
debutar
to make one's initial formal appearance
Release 3.2 debuted to mixed reviews in Spring of 2004.
The nine-car electric unit debuted on the 0630 Newcastle-London King's Cross.
